Ordinals
beta
Address 3Ac9R72Z5Mqg1rFc8pHTd9Zo3FtDm3BH7k
sat balance
16727
runes balances
outputs
c2859900d662507f8c5ec3454a1c4368efc826c5ce543e908230b6814a97afd4:0